The steps are<br />
1. Underst<strong>and</strong> the exist<strong>in</strong>g issues<br />
2. Assign costs<br />
3. Model “as is”<br />
4. Model “to be”<br />
5. Def<strong>in</strong>e value po<strong>in</strong>ts<br />
6. Def<strong>in</strong>e hard benefits<br />
7. Def<strong>in</strong>e soft benefits<br />
8. Create f<strong>in</strong>al bus<strong>in</strong>ess case<br />
<strong>Step</strong> 1: Underst<strong>and</strong> the Exist<strong>in</strong>g Issues<br />
This is the big one. You need to list all of the exist<strong>in</strong>g bus<strong>in</strong>ess <strong>and</strong> IT issues.<br />
These are typically issues that h<strong>in</strong>der productivity or are major bus<strong>in</strong>ess processes<br />
that need attention. They should be detailed enough that you are def<strong>in</strong><strong>in</strong>g<br />
a legitimate issue but not so detailed that you get lost <strong>in</strong> the m<strong>in</strong>utia.<br />
Moreover, you need to pick a doma<strong>in</strong>. If yours is a Global 2000 company,<br />
then the enterprise is just too big; the problem doma<strong>in</strong> needs to be a subset<br />
of systems that have the potential to become a project go<strong>in</strong>g forward—a<br />
project that should take less than a year to complete. So, keep your doma<strong>in</strong>s<br />
relevant but not too big. The sales automation system for an auto manufacturer<br />
would be an example of a good doma<strong>in</strong> for creat<strong>in</strong>g a bus<strong>in</strong>ess case for<br />
cloud comput<strong>in</strong>g; the entire parts division of the auto manufacturer, consist<strong>in</strong>g<br />
of 100 systems, would perhaps be too big.<br />
Aga<strong>in</strong>, put them <strong>in</strong> bus<strong>in</strong>ess <strong>and</strong> IT buckets. For example, let’s list issues<br />
for a sales automation doma<strong>in</strong>. These are just examples, m<strong>in</strong>d you:<br />
